1.9.18p4 smbpasswd
no complaints, just a little something that i noticed with smbpasswd in 1.9.18p4 that is not clear from the documentation (WHATSNEW.txt or the smbpasswd man page)... if you try to change your samba password without specifying the remote hostname (-r hostname) the connection is from/to localhost and it will fail unless you have localhost in your 'hosts allow' setting in smb.conf. you will

1.9.18p4 smbpasswd and unix sync with sunos 5.5 nis server
i found the following to work for syncing samba and unix passwords. my environment is: sunos 5.5 samba-1.9.18p4 samba password server is also nis master server in smb.conf: allow hosts = localhost [ + whatever other hosts you want to allow ] unix password sync = yes passwd program = /bin/passwd -r files %u; cd /var/yp; make passwd passwd chat = *New\spassword:* "%n\n"

Freebsd + NT/Nt-Client am Linux-Server
Pam_SMB allows Linux clients to validate their passwords against an NT PDC, so the only thing you have to do is set up the accounts on the Linux side with an '*' in the /etc/passwd entry. This can be done using a list of users: #!/bin/bash for i in `cat myuserlist`; do /usr/sbin/adduser -p '*' $i with various other command line options, such as "-s
